Robert
This was a difficult character for me to learn because it starts with 史(history) then jumps to 使(cause). For some weird mental connection reason, I found that I needed to differentiate and link the characters together with the intermediate character 吏(government official). then when I write 使 I see the pieces of the pictogram better and I dont miss out any part of the final character.
Abigail
What's the difference between 因 and 使 to mean 'cause'?
Mandarin Blueprint
使 is more formal, and is more like "to make (something happen/someone do something), rather than "because"
